2. SharePoint Website vs SharePoint Intranet
It is important to understand the difference between a SharePoint website and a SharePoint intranet. A SharePoint website is a public-facing site that can be accessed by external users, while a SharePoint intranet is a private network that is only accessible to employees within the organization. The design and functionality of a SharePoint intranet are tailored to meet the internal communication and collaboration needs of the organization.
3. SharePoint Onpremise vs SharePoint Online
SharePoint can be deployed either on-premise or in the cloud. SharePoint on-premise refers to the installation and hosting of SharePoint within an organization’s own infrastructure, while SharePoint Online is a cloud-based version of SharePoint that is hosted and managed by Microsoft. The choice between SharePoint on-premise and SharePoint Online depends on factors such as security requirements, scalability, and IT infrastructure.
4. Intranet Design Best Practices
When designing an intranet, there are several best practices that should be followed to ensure its effectiveness:
- User-Centric Design: The intranet should be designed with the needs and preferences of the users in mind. It should be intuitive, easy to navigate, and visually appealing.
- Clear Information Architecture: The information on the intranet should be organized in a logical and hierarchical manner, making it easy for users to find what they are looking for.
- Mobile-Friendly Design: With the increasing use of mobile devices, it is important to ensure that the intranet is responsive and can be accessed on different screen sizes.
- Integration with Other Systems: The intranet should be integrated with other systems and tools used within the organization, such as email, document management, and project management tools.
- Regular Updates and Maintenance: The intranet should be regularly updated with new content and features, and any issues or bugs should be promptly addressed.
